.article-page .container{max-width:890px}.article-page__breadcrumb a{text-decoration:underline}.article-page__header{max-width:750px;text-transform:none;letter-spacing:normal;color:var(--color-primary-text)}p{margin-top:0;margin-bottom:1rem}.article-page__content h1,.article-page__content h2,.article-page__content h3,.article-page__content h4,.article-page__content h5,.article-page__content h6{font-family:var(--font-body-bold);text-transform:none;letter-spacing:normal;color:#424242}.article-page__content p,.article-page__content li{color:#727272;font-size:20px;line-height:168.2%}.article-page__content ul,.article-page__content ol{padding-left:30px}.article-page__content li{list-style:disc;margin-bottom:10px}.article-page__content ol,.article-page__content ul,.article-page__content dl{margin-top:0;margin-bottom:1rem}.article-page__content h2,.article-page__content h3,.article-page__content h4{font-size:35px;line-height:45px;margin-bottom:20px}.article-page__content a{text-decoration-line:underline;text-decoration-thickness:from-font;color:rgba(var(--color-foreground),1);font-family:var(--font-body-medium)}.article-page__content a.btn{background:#06c996;border-radius:5px;font-size:16px;line-height:168.2%;color:#fff;font-family:var(--font-body-bold);text-decoration:none;text-transform:none;letter-spacing:0;padding:11px 63px;display:inline-block;margin:30px 0}.article-page__content p:first-child{padding-left:0!important}.article-page__content p:first-child img{width:100%;height:auto}.article-page__content div:first-child img:first-child{width:100%;margin-bottom:10px}.article-page__content img{display:block;margin:0 auto}.article-page .social-sharing a{color:#424242;width:43px;height:43px;display:inline-flex;align-items:center;justify-content:center;border-radius:50%;background-color:#f7f7f7;margin-right:15px}.article-page .social-sharing .icon{height:auto}.article-page__sign-up form{background-color:transparent!important;border-radius:0!important;padding:0!important}.article-page__sign-up form div{padding:0!important}.article-page__sign-up form .ql-snow.ql-container.ql-disabled{display:none!important}.article-page__sign-up form input{height:43px!important;font-size:15px!important;line-height:22px;color:#979797!important;width:100%!important;max-width:313px!important;background-color:#fffdfd!important;border:1px solid #D6D6D6!important;border-radius:6px!important;margin-bottom:17px!important}.article-page__sign-up form input:hover{border-color:#d6d6d6!important;box-shadow:none!important}.article-page__sign-up form button{height:42px!important;max-width:140px!important;padding:0 10px!important;border:1px solid #FF3D5E!important;box-sizing:border-box;border-radius:4px!important;background-color:transparent!important;font-size:14px;color:#ff3d5e!important;margin-top:24px;text-transform:none!important;font-family:var(--font-body-medium)!important}.article-page__sign-up__sub{font-size:14px;line-height:23px;color:#ff3d5e;font-family:var(--font-body-medium);margin-bottom:3px}.article-page__sign-up__desc{font-size:14px;line-height:23px;font-family:var(--font-body-family);color:#5f5f5f;max-width:376px;margin-bottom:11px}.blog-list__guides{margin-bottom:261px}.article-page-column{display:grid;grid-template-columns:1fr 288px;max-width:1210px;margin:auto;grid-gap:30px}.article-page-column .blog-sidebar__banners{width:100%;max-width:100%;padding-left:0}.sidebar-banner{position:relative;margin-bottom:25px;padding:25px 22px;width:308px;max-width:100%;background-position:center;background-size:cover;background-repeat:no-repeat;border-radius:10px;display:flex;flex-direction:column;justify-content:space-between}.sidebar-banner .block__heading{text-align:left;margin:0 0 17.5px;font-family:var(--font-heading-family);font-weight:500;font-size:32px;line-height:1;word-wrap:break-word;color:#222;text-transform:uppercase;letter-spacing:-.01em}.pulse-banner h3,.pulse-banner .h3{text-align:center}.sidebar-banner h3,.sidebar-banner .h3{margin-bottom:10px;text-align:center}.heart-rate{max-width:180px;height:80px;position:relative;margin:0 auto;top:0;overflow:hidden;text-align:center}.fade-in{position:absolute;width:100%;height:100%;background-color:#ecf7f4;top:0;right:0;animation:heartRateIn 4.5s linear infinite}.fade-out{position:absolute;width:120%;height:100%;top:0;left:-120%;animation:heartRateOut 4.5s linear infinite;background:#ecf7f4;background:-moz-linear-gradient(left,#ecf7f4 0%,#ecf7f4 50%,rgba(255,255,255,0) 100%);background:-webkit-linear-gradient(left,#ecf7f4 0%,#ecf7f4 50%,rgba(255,255,255,0) 100%);background:-o-linear-gradient(left,#ecf7f4 0%,#ecf7f4 50%,rgba(255,255,255,0) 100%);background:-ms-linear-gradient(left,#ecf7f4 0%,#ecf7f4 50%,rgba(255,255,255,0) 100%);background:linear-gradient(to right,#ecf7f4 0% 80%,#fff0)}.sidebar-banner p{font-size:14px;line-height:1.5;color:#222;margin:0 0 19.44444px}@keyframes heartRateIn{0%{width:100%}50%{width:0%}to{width:0}}@keyframes heartRateOut{0%{left:-120%}30%{left:-120%}to{left:0}}.sidebar-banner .btn{margin-top:9px;-moz-user-select:none;-ms-user-select:none;-webkit-user-select:none;user-select: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;display:inline-block;width:100%;text-decoration:none;text-align:center;vertical-align:middle;cursor:pointer;border:1px solid transparent;border-radius:8px;padding:10px 18px;background-color:#ff3d5e;color:#fff;font-family:var(--font-body-bold);font-weight:400;text-transform:uppercase;letter-spacing:.08em;white-space:normal;font-size:14px}.sidebar-banner .meet_happy{position:absolute;right:48px;top:11px}.sidebar-banner aside{margin-bottom:2px;margin-top:15px;color:#222;font-family:var(--font-body-bold);font-size:12px;line-height:1.5;letter-spacing:.08em;text-transform:uppercase}.sidebar-banner .huge{font-size:43px;line-height:37.8px}@media only screen and (max-width: 989px){.sidebar-banner{margin:0 auto 15px;width:100%;min-height:0!important;background-position-y:30%}}@media (max-width: 980px) and (min-width: 768px){.article-page-column{padding-right:20px}}@media (max-width: 890px){.article-page-column{grid-template-columns:1fr}.article-page-column .blog-sidebar__banners{padding:0 22px;max-width:320px;margin-left:auto;margin-right:auto;margin-bottom:100px}}@media screen and (max-width: 767px){.article-page__breadcrumb{font-size:15px}.article-page__header{font-size:40px;line-height:47px}.article-page__sign-up form button{width:100%;max-width:313px!important}.sidebar-banner .btn{padding:8px 15px}.article-page__content li,.article-page__content p{font-size:16px;line-height:31px}.article-page__content h2,.article-page__content h3,.article-page__content h4{font-size:25px;line-height:33px}}
/*# sourceMappingURL=/cdn/shop/t/287/assets/blog-post-general.css.map */
